Cape Cod Healthcare, Inc. HR Business Partner in Hyannis, Massachusetts

Purpose of Position: Reporting to the Human Resources Manager, the Human Resources (HR) Business Partner is responsible for developing & executing HR strategy in support of assigned business units & their objectives. Assesses & anticipates HR-related needs, communicating proactively with HR subject matter experts & management to develop integrated solutions. Formulates partnerships across the HR organization to deliver value-added service to management & employees that reflects the mission & business objectives of the organization. Helps to drive HR initiatives related to recruitment, employee engagement, employee relations, performance management, culture, change management, workforce planning, people development & coaching. Description Conducts regular meetings with assigned business units, partnering with management to develop & execute both long-term & short-term HR strategies that directly support & enable business objectives; Educates & advises management & employees regarding HR policies, processes & practices; ensures that HR policies & collective bargaining agreements are applied accurately & consistently; Analyzes trends & metrics in partnership with other HR staff to develop solutions, programs & policies; Supports building organizational capabilities while reducing complexity & partnering with business units to maximize team performance; Manages & resolves complex employee relations issues. Conducts effective, thorough & objective investigations; recommends course of action & ensures consistency & fairness in all resolutions; Provides timely, effective & direct coaching to managers & employees, assisting in the development of strong, contemporary leadership skills; Maintains in-depth knowledge of legal requirements related to day-to-day management of employees, reducing legal risks & ensuring regulatory compliance. Consults with internal senior legal counsel as needed & required; Provides day-to-day performance management guidance to management (e.g., coaching, counseling, career development, disciplinary actions); Works closely with management & employees to improve work relationships, build morale, & increase engagement, productivity, & retention; Provides guidance & input on business unit restructures, workforce planning & succession planning; Identifies training needs for business units & individual coaching needs; Participates in evaluation, monitoring, & delivery of training programs to ensure success; Analyzes a variety of data, composes appropriate reports for management & advises in the development & implementation of action plans required based on data analysis; Provides ongoing assessment & coaching to managers & employees, & recommends development plans where needed; Ensures the availability & acquisition of appropriate talent in the right numbers, with the right skill mix, at the right time & place to meet ongoing organizational needs; Serves as the liaison between HR & other administrative departments within the organization; Conducts new hire orientations & ensures a thorough assimilation of each employee into their department & the organization; Qualifications Bachelor\'s degree & at least 5 years of HR experience, or equivalent combination of education & experience; PHR or SPHR designation a plus; Experience working in a large, fast-paced organization; Experience resolving complex employee relations issues; Working knowledge of multiple human resources disciplines, including compensation practices, organizational development, employee & labor relations, performance management, & federal & state employment laws; Knowledge of Joint Commission Accreditation of Healthcare Organizations (JCAHO) standards as they related to human resources; Experience working with collective bargaining agreements; See completer job description when applying. Schedule Details: Full-Time, M-F, Occ. Weekends, & Occ. Holidays
